Classroom Conversations: The Path To Wall Street

Classroom Conversations: The Path To Wall Street
Posted By: Tracy Boleware on April 22, 2022


In honor of National Financial Education Month, The Black Executive & Student Training Program (The BEST Program), in partnership with World of Money.org and The YWCA of Metropolitan Chicago will be hosting a 90-minute virtual event for students on "The Path To Wall Street" that will detail what students need to know to get an internship and create their own path to a career on wall street. The event is scheduled for Monday, April 25th from 3:00 pm - 4:30 pm ET

This is an important event for students as they will have access to senior level executives working in the financial services industry that can give the key insights and practical advice on how to navigate the often-intimidating world of financial services.



Our speakers include


Sabrina Lamb, Founder and Executive Director, World of Money.org
Derrick Warren, Assistant Dean, School of Business, Southern University
Mark Ferguson, Founder and CEO, Innervation Finance Group
Walter K. Booker, COO at MarketCounsel and Chairman Emeritus Sponsors for Educational Opportunity (SEO)
Garrett Collins, Real Estate Private Equity Analyst, Angelo Gordon
